In this blog, we’ll focus on must-have decoration items to make your Lohri celebrations vibrant and memorable. Essential Lohri Decoration Items for Your Home 1. Traditional Fabrics and Drapes Phulkari Dupattas: Use them as table runners, wall hangings, or drapes. Bright-colored cotton fabrics in red, yellow, and orange hues to add vibrancy. Embroidered cushions and floor mats for seating arrangements. Pair these decorations with a Lohri Special Food to make your celebration even more festive. 2. Floral Decorations Fresh marigold garlands for doors, walls, and windows. Rose petals for table centerpieces or rangoli designs. Artificial flowers for long-lasting decor options. 3. Lighting Items Fairy Lights: String them around your home for a warm, festive glow. Traditional brass oil lamps to light up your pooja space. Candles in glass jars, decorated with dried flowers or colored grains. 4. Earthen Pots and Baskets Painted clay pots for table centerpieces or as decor elements. Traditional baskets filled with sugarcane, peanuts, popcorn, and rewri. Use earthen pots to enhance the authenticity of your decorations. Learn more about Why We Celebrate Lohri and its rich traditions. 5. Props and Handcrafted Items Kites symbolizing Lohri’s festive spirit, hung around your home. Miniature Punjabi dhols and mudhas for a traditional touch. Handmade paper garlands to decorate walls and doorways. 6. Bonfire Essentials A safe, fire-resistant area for the Lohri Bonfire, the centerpiece of the celebration. Surround the bonfire with hay bales, clay pots, and lanterns. Keep baskets of festive snacks like til laddoos and gachak nearby for guests. Read about the significance of Lohri Bonfires and how they bring people together. 7. Tableware and Dining Decor Brass or copper plates and bowls for serving festive food. Decorated tablecloths and mats with traditional Punjabi patterns. Display sweets and snacks in aesthetically pleasing trays.
